This trail is on the tongue of land between the West and East Forks of the Eno River. Most of the trail mirrors one of these two forks and rolls up and down between the lowlands and the hills along the creek.
The lowlands are full of Carolina Spicebush, while the higher country is a mix of hardwoods with a few pine trees. Spotted along the trail are access points to be able to get down to the water and fish.
Running through the center of the trail is are a couple of meadows that provide the bigger views of the landscape.
